About the survey

An online survey was sent to 4,237 superintendent members of GCSAA in the United States. The final response set of completed surveys totaled 761 of the 4,237 distributed, a response rate of 18%.

Respondents were asked questions about topics such as computer usage, software usage, irrigation computer usage and smart phone usage. Results are reported by age, greens fee, facility type and number of holes.
